Ticket #4471: Expired credentials for crash-report ingestion. Plugin authors for the Larkspin mobile SDK: the shared ingest credential for the Quillhaven crash-report pipeline expired on the 14th, which is why your test crashes stopped appearing in the dashboard. Uploads are silently dropped with a 401 until you update your plugin config. The retention window means nothing was lost if you resubmit within seven days. Rotation is complete on our side and no further changes are planned this quarter. The replacement key is below.

service key, fawip-bajef: kto11_Qt5wZK9vdNC

The Quillbrook loyalty-points ledger previously read its write-access credential from LEDGER_KEY. That name collided with the reporting service's export key and caused at least one silent misconfiguration in staging. As of this release the ledger reads LEDGER_WRITE_TOKEN instead; the old name is ignored and a warning is logged at startup. Maintainers upgrading an existing deployment must update the ledger's .env before restarting, otherwise point accrual writes will fail closed. Replace the old entry with the following line:

sealed setting: VAULT_KEY3=eec

Ticket #—: Pop-up office, Harwick Trade Fair

Facilities desk: the pop-up office at the Harwick fairgrounds (Hall C, stand row 14) is now fitted out. Two lockable cabinets, router, and the demo units from the Velstra team are inside. Cleaning is contracted through the venue; report any issues via this ticket, not directly to hall staff. The unit must be locked whenever unattended, even briefly, as hall security is minimal overnight. The keypad code for the pop-up door is below.

door code, yagap-bahof: bdg-O-05

Subject: PointsBook ledger key rotation — heads up

Hi all,

Quick note for whoever inherits this later: we rotated the service key for PointsBook, our loyalty-points ledger, as part of the quarterly sweep. The old key stops working Friday at noon, so update the ledger-sync workers and the nightly reconciliation job before then. Staging was already switched over and looks happy. Everything else (endpoints, scopes, rate limits) stays exactly the same. For convenience, the new key is included below.

app token of bawep-hafog = kto7_vwrmnlx